We all know about the constant value of DARE (for example, in regard to our
recent discussion, see "hissy"), but here's an opportunity to mention another
resource by a fellow ADS member, namely Safire's New Political Dictionary
(Random House, 1993) by William Safire.

It does not obviate the need for OED, DA, DAE, DARE, etc, but see

yellow dog Democrat: an unswerving party loyalist; used only as a compliment.
(Safire then goes on to explain how the negative term "yellow dog" became
positive in terms of the 1928 Presidential election.)
